Course Outline

This course is divided into 7 modules with the primary goal of achieving pure skills. These easy-to-understand modules are all designed to equip you with a new set of skills at each interval. All of the modules are defined in detail below.

Module 1: Getting Started With Mehndi

This module will help you understand a brief history of mehndi and the influence it holds in South Asian culture. Your mentor will elaborate on the importance of patience while learning new skills in her course. By the end of this module, you’ll be educated on the prerequisite utilities to start mehndi.

Module 2: Practicing Line Art

As the name suggests, you’ll be practicing line art in this segment of the course. Line art is an important part of the core technique of drawing. Since mehndi art is hugely influenced by line art, it will be a key takeaway from this course. Meanwhile, various exercises will be shared with you to enhance your line art.

Module 3: Practicing Grids

In this module, a wide range of grids will be practiced to help you better understand the use of lines and the minute details of the art. Since mehndi, or henna art, is heavily dependent on the use of shapes, lines, and grids, these modules will help you forever, even beyond the henna design.

Module 4: Mehndi Cone Handling

The cone handling will be the very first step for you to get started with proper mehndi utensils. The handling of the henna cone affects the end results tremendously, so this module will ask you to pay careful attention to your mentor’s words and gestures. 

Module 5: Practicing Basic Mehndi Designs

Learners who already know how to handle a mehndi cone will be excited to learn more about this segment. Your mentor, Saamia, will be helping you to design very basic patterns used in traditional mehndi art. Some of these patterns are the most requested by henna fans. These basic designs will incorporate leaf making, flower making, and basic shapes.

Module 6: Practicing Advanced Mehndi Designs

Once you get used to the basic designs, you’ll progress towards learning some more complex designs. These designs are termed "advanced" due to the fact that they require extraordinary attention to detail. You’ll be guided by your mentor on how to get the minute details right and avoid mistakes. This module will cover subjects like fillings and mandalas.

Module 7: Final Mehndi Application on Hands

Applying all of your learning is the best way to evaluate your progress. And what better than your own mentor joining you on the journey of final application? Saamia Malik will apply mehndi on her hand while making sure that every tip and trick she has shared with you is included. While addressing the mistakes redeeming tips during mehndi, she’ll design a unique mehndi art.

Meet Your Mentor

Henna Artist & Entrepreneur Saamia Malik

Saamia Malik is a teacher by profession but a henna artist by passion. She self-taught henna herself by picking up the henna cone at the early age of just 12 years. Since 2017, she has been professionally serving her clients through this art. Saamia is also an entrepreneur and has been successfully running her mehndi business since then. She started her henna art journey with the objective of teaching it to the masses. She aspires to see a henna artist in every household to keep the spirit of festive occasions alive.
